- Eamon De Buitléar was born on January 22, 1930 in Bray, Co. Wicklow, Ireland. Eamon was a cinematographer and director, known for Islandman: The Story of the Last Trading Skipper of a Galway Hooker (2003), An Saol Beo (1974) and Man About Dog (2004). Eamon was married to Eibhlin 'Lailli' Lamb. Eamon died on January 27, 2013 in Delgany, Co. Wicklow, Ireland.

- In November 2012,he donated his entire archive of film, music and writings to the National University of Ireland, Galway.
- He was Ireland's best known independent wildlife film-maker since the 1960s.
- He is survived by his wife, Lailli, and five children, Aoife, Éanna, Róisín, Cian and Doireann, grandchildren, great-grandchildren, sisters and brothers.
